Intric joins the Swedish Security & Defence Industry Association

Intric is now a member of Säkerhets- och försvarsföretagen (SOFF), the trade association representing Sweden's defence and security sector. The membership reflects a deliberate choice to deepen our work with the institutions where sovereign AI infrastructure matters most.

Defence and security organisations work under frameworks that are non-negotiable, they must retain control over their AI systems and the data they process, they must operate within their own jurisdiction, and they must be able to demonstrate compliance at every step. Intric is built for exactly these requirements.

Defence and security organisations across Europe are operationalising AI at scale. They need partners who understand that this infrastructure cannot be outsourced or compromised. SOFF membership is how we signal that we're built for exactly that work.

About Intric

Intric develops secure, sovereign and compliant AI infrastructure for public authorities and critical institutions. The platform enables organisations to deploy AI assistants and agents based on their own data, under their own governance, and without dependency on external cloud infrastructure. Intric is developed in Sweden and is in active operation at regulated institutions across the Nordics and Germany. Founded in 2021, headquartered in Stockholm. www.intric.ai.
